Category FAQ

Which drill bit is best for cuticle work?

Flame and finer diamond shapes are commonly used for controlled cuticle work depending on the pressure, grit, and salon method.

What is a mandrel used for?

A mandrel holds sanding bands or caps so they can be used safely with an e-file during prep and refining stages.

When should carbide bits be used?

Carbide bits are typically used for faster product removal and stronger refining when salon speed and control are both important.

Why do bits feel rough or unsafe in use?

Bits can feel unsafe when the wrong grit or shape is chosen, when rotation speed is too high, or when the tool is used without enough control.
